The due diligence process is an organized method to exploring and reviewing a service chance before wrapping up a transaction. This thorough assessment offers numerous functions: it validates the precision of info provided by the vendor, recognizes prospective risks and responsibilities, reveals surprise chances for worth production, and offers the foundation for negotiating favorable terms. An extensive due diligence examination typically includes financial evaluation, operational analysis, lawful testimonial, market examination, and governing conformity verification. Each of these components plays a vital role in building a complete understanding of business and its prospects. Financial due diligence checks out profits streams, revenue margins, cash flow patterns, financial obligation obligations, and the quality of incomes to make certain that the economic photo offered properly mirrors truth. This evaluation goes beyond approving monetary statements at stated value, rather excavating right into the underlying purchases, accounting plans, and assumptions that drive the numbers.
Operational due diligence focuses on just how business in fact operates on an everyday basis, checking out every little thing from supply chain relationships and client concentrations to employee abilities and administration systems. This aspect of due diligence often reveals important dependencies, functional inadequacies, or concealed staminas that don't show up in financial declarations yet significantly impact the business's worth and future performance. Legal due diligence assesses agreements, copyright rights, litigation history, governing conformity, and corporate framework to identify potential lawful threats or obligations that might impact the deal or future procedures. Market due diligence analyzes the affordable landscape, client dynamics, sector fads, and development possibility to verify presumptions about the business's market position and future leads. Throughout this process, experienced due diligence specialists recognize what questions to ask, where to seek potential issues, and how to analyze findings in the context of your specific purposes and take the chance of tolerance. The objective is not just to compile information, however to synthesize it right into actionable understandings that educate your decision-making and negotiation strategy.
Financial due diligence develops the keystone of any type of detailed organization examination, supplying the measurable structure whereupon financial investment decisions are made. This process entails an in-depth assessment of historical monetary performance, existing monetary placement, and predicted future results to determine whether the business stands for sound value at the suggested transaction cost. Professional monetary due diligence goes much past just examining audited financial statements or income tax return. It includes examining the quality of earnings by identifying single occasions, non-recurring products, related celebration deals, and accounting policies that may pump up or deflate reported earnings. This analysis helps stabilize profits to mirror real lasting efficiency of the business, offering a much more precise basis for assessment and decision-making. Cash flow evaluation is similarly essential, as successful companies can still deal with liquidity difficulties if cash is bound in supply, receivables, or capital investment. Understanding the business's cash conversion cycle, functioning funding needs, and capital expenditure needs is necessary for planning post-transaction financing and operations.
Business evaluation solutions complement financial due diligence by establishing what business is actually worth based upon several approaches and market benchmarks. Appraisal strategies may consist of equivalent business evaluation, criterion purchase evaluation, discounted cash flow modeling, and asset-based appraisal, with the suitable methods relying on the nature of business and the transaction. A specialist valuation takes into consideration not only historical performance however also development leads, affordable positioning, consumer relationships, intellectual property, and other abstract assets that add to worth. This analysis supplies an objective assessment of whether the asking rate is practical and helps determine the crucial worth vehicle drivers that should be secured or enhanced post-transaction. Financial due diligence additionally takes a look at business's financial debt framework, contingent liabilities, off-balance-sheet commitments, and tax positions to determine any kind of concealed economic risks that might affect returns. Recognizing the tax implications of the purchase structure, prospective direct exposure from previous tax placements, and chances for tax obligation optimization is critical for maximizing after-tax returns. Throughout the financial due diligence process, experienced professionals keep a healthy suspicion, screening presumptions, verifying information sources, and looking for disparities that may indicate problems needing additional investigation.
While financial analysis tells you what has taken place in the past, functional and commercial due diligence helps you recognize just how business really works and whether it can supply the future performance you're anticipating. Operational due diligence examines the business's core procedures, systems, and capacities to evaluate efficiency, scalability, and possible susceptabilities. This consists of examining the supply chain to recognize dependences on vital vendors, examine stock monitoring practices, and recognize cost structures. Client concentration analysis is especially crucial, as companies that obtain a huge percent of profits from a handful of customers deal with significant danger if those partnerships transform. Recognizing consumer procurement costs, retention rates, lifetime value, and complete satisfaction degrees supplies insight right into the sustainability of income streams and the stamina of consumer partnerships. Technology Aesthetiq Brokers infrastructure analysis analyzes the systems that support organization procedures, including their adequacy, scalability, safety, and compliance with market requirements. In today's digital organization setting, outdated or insufficient modern technology can represent a substantial concealed expense that needs to be addressed post-transaction.
Human funding assessment is another critical element of functional due diligence, as the people that run the business typically represent its most useful possession, especially in solution businesses or those based on specialized expertise. This assessment analyzes organizational framework, essential person reliances, staff member abilities, settlement frameworks, and cultural factors that can influence retention and performance post-transaction. Recognizing whether essential employees are likely to stay after the deal and what incentives or setups may be needed to keep important talent is necessary for transition planning. Commercial due diligence focuses on the market environment in which the business operates, consisting of affordable dynamics, industry patterns, governing adjustments, and growth possibilities. This analysis verifies the presumptions underlying economic estimates by examining whether the market problems essential to accomplish predicted growth in fact exist. It checks out the business's competitive positioning, differentiation methods, valuing power, and barriers to access that shield market share. Recognizing client requirements, acquiring patterns, and contentment degrees via customer meetings or studies can supply beneficial insights not readily available from internal papers alone. Commercial due diligence likewise determines potential synergies with existing operations or opportunities to enhance value with operational renovations, market growth, or critical repositioning.
Legal due diligence is vital for identifying prospective obligations, legal obligations, and compliance issues that could affect the deal or produce unanticipated expenses down the road. This thorough review takes a look at corporate framework and administration, making certain that the entity is effectively organized, all called for filings are existing, and company procedures have actually been observed. Product agreements are examined to recognize essential commercial relationships, recognize modification of control stipulations that might be set off by the purchase, and examine whether terms agree with or develop unanticipated commitments. This consists of client agreements, distributor contracts, employment contract, leases, loan documents, and any kind of various other arrangements that could significantly impact business. Comprehending which contracts can be designated, which call for permission for transfer, and which might be terminated as a result of the transaction is critical for preparing the bargain structure and transition. Copyright evaluation examines business's ownership of hallmarks, patents, copyrights, trade secrets, and various other intangible possessions, validating that proper enrollments are in area and that there are no infringement concerns or conflicts that can affect the business's capacity to operate.
Litigation history and prospective lawful exposures are examined to identify any kind of pending or intimidated lawsuits, regulative examinations, or conflicts that might cause economic responsibility or functional interruption. Also organizations without current litigation might have exposure from past activities, legal relationships, or regulative conformity issues that can emerge later on. Employment and labor legislation conformity is examined to make certain adherence to wage and hour regulations, employee category requirements, workplace safety and security policies, and anti-discrimination laws. Non-compliance in these areas can cause significant charges and back repayments that influence the business's value. Environmental due diligence evaluates conformity with environmental guidelines and recognizes any kind of possible contamination or removal commitments, specifically crucial for companies with making procedures or real property holdings. Regulative compliance review checks out adherence to industry-specific regulations, licensing demands, information personal privacy regulations, and various other legal commitments that put on business's procedures. In extremely regulated sectors such as health care, monetary solutions, or food production, conformity issues can be specifically intricate and costly. The legal due diligence procedure additionally analyzes the structure of the suggested transaction to determine optimum techniques for lessening tax obligation responsibility, shielding versus known dangers, and helping with smooth assimilation post-closing.
A fundamental objective of due diligence is to identify and evaluate dangers so they can be effectively assessed, priced right into the purchase, or reduced via deal framework or post-closing actions. Detailed risk analysis analyzes monetary risks such as revenue volatility, margin pressure, debt solution commitments, and functioning funding needs that could affect capital and returns. Functional risks include reliances on crucial suppliers or customers, innovation vulnerabilities, ability restrictions, and quality assurance concerns that could interrupt operations or damage track record. Market dangers encompass competitive hazards, transforming consumer choices, technological interruption, and financial factors that could affect demand for the business's service or products. Governing and conformity threats consist of prospective adjustments in regulations or guidelines, pending enforcement activities, or locations of non-compliance that could result in fines or need expensive remediation. Tactical risks include the prospective failing to accomplish forecasted harmonies, integration obstacles, essential employee departures, or imbalance between the acquired company and the purchaser's capacities or objectives.
Once dangers are recognized and examined, establishing proper mitigation methods is essential for protecting your investment and making best use of the possibility of deal success. Some threats can be attended to through purchase cost changes that mirror the price of dealing with determined problems or the impact of adverse findings on organization value. Earnouts or contingent consideration structures can move some threat to the seller by linking a section of the purchase cost to future efficiency, lining up motivations and providing security if business doesn't do as expected. Representations and service warranties in the acquisition agreement assign threat in between customer and vendor, with indemnification provisions providing recourse if violations are discovered post-closing. Sometimes, depiction and warranty insurance can be used to supply added defense and assist in cleaner offer structures. Escrow arrangements keep back a part of the acquisition rate to cover prospective cases or unidentified obligations. Transition services agreements make sure continuity of important features throughout the combination duration, while employment agreements and non-compete provisions secure against vital person departures or affordable dangers. Developing a detailed combination plan that deals with identified dangers and maximize possibilities is important for recognizing the value you get out of the transaction. The risk evaluation procedure should inevitably inform your go/no-go choice, assist you negotiate ideal terms and rate, and assist your post-closing concerns for protecting and enhancing the value of your investment.
Due diligence does not end when the transaction closes; in fact, the understandings gotten during the due diligence process give the foundation for successful post-acquisition assimilation. Integration preparation need to start throughout the due diligence stage, making use of the info collected to identify vital priorities, possible challenges, and possibilities for worth development. A thorough combination strategy addresses business structure, defining reporting connections, decision-making authority, and exactly how the acquired service will fit within the broader organization. Interaction technique is essential, ensuring that workers, customers, distributors, and other stakeholders comprehend the transaction rationale, what will alter, and what will certainly stay the very same. Clear, regular communication assists manage uncertainty, maintain morale, and maintain key partnerships throughout the transition period. Equipments integration planning addresses exactly how innovation platforms, accounting systems, and functional procedures will be aligned or incorporated, balancing the benefits of standardization versus the prices and dangers of disruption.
Cultural assimilation is usually ignored but critically vital, particularly when integrating organizations with different worths, working styles, or management methods. Requiring time to comprehend the obtained company's culture, determine locations of positioning and difference, and thoughtfully manage the social integration process can dramatically impact worker retention and lasting success. Quick wins ought to be identified and focused on, showing worth from the transaction and structure energy for longer-term campaigns. These may consist of operational enhancements, price reduction possibilities, or earnings harmonies that can be understood fairly swiftly with manageable risk. Risk reduction activities identified during due diligence needs to be integrated into the assimilation plan with clear possession, timelines, and success metrics. This may include addressing conformity spaces, branching out customer or supplier focus, upgrading innovation infrastructure, or enhancing management abilities in crucial locations. Efficiency tracking systems ought to be developed to track progression versus integration purposes and recognize issues early when they're easier to attend to. Routine assimilation team meetings, clear rise courses for concerns, and exec sponsorship aid guarantee that combination stays on track and obtains the interest and resources it calls for. The due diligence procedure supplies a riches of information concerning the business, its opportunities, and its challenges. Leveraging these understandings to establish and perform a thoughtful assimilation plan is crucial for recognizing the worth you visualized when you made a decision to pursue the transaction.
